Results, order, filter

Travelers Insurance Company Careers 2 Jobs in Glens Falls, NY

  • Sr Director, Business Process Management – Business Systems Support

    Travelers Insurance Company - Glens Falls, New York
    ... culture of innovation and efficiency across the enterprise. The Business Process Management (BPM) team is ... insight into enterprise initiatives, you will assess the impact of ongoing initiatives and leverage them ...
  • Director, Learning Partner - PI Learning Effectiveness

    Travelers Insurance Company - Glens Falls, New York
    ... Enterprise Learning Enablement. What Will You Do? The below duties are expectations either as ... Operating Review Assess and implement new tech solutions presented by Enterprise Learning Enablement ...